Summary/Abstract: The question of salvation lies at the roots of theological inquiry. As one of the theological disciplines, soteriology treats the question of salvation in a systematic manner. Salvation, however, does not simply represent a general object of theological research, as it is also an anthropological category and touches upon the fate of every individual. Within this context, theology developed its doctrine of grace through which it seeks to answer the question of the conditions and forms of salvation for every individual. Hans Urs von Balthasar composed a theological treatise about salvation in the form of socaled dramatic soteriology that includes the rudiments of the doctrine of grace. This article seeks to outline the essential points and principles of Balthasar’s dramatic soteriology.
